タグ

関連タグで絞り込む (206)

タグの絞り込みを解除

Flashに関するt_43zのブックマーク (229)

  • MOONGIFT: � Rubyで作られたRTMPサーバ「RubyIZUMI」:オープンソースを毎日紹介

    Youtubeから爆発的に広がった動画共有の流れは、次第に画質を求める時代になりつつある。既にH.264に対応しているFlashプレーヤに合わせて、各種動画サイトでは高画質な動画を提供し始めている。 H.264の動画はかなり美しく、拡大しても十分みられるものだ。そんな高画質配信サービスを自分でも構築してみたいならこれを試してみよう。 今回紹介するオープンソース・ソフトウェアはRubyIZUMI、Rubyで開発されたRTMPサーバだ。 RTMPは旧マクロメディアが開発したストリーム用プロトコルだ(rtmp://〜で指定する)。ストリーミング配信なので、キャッシュに蓄積されることなく動画をながせるというメリットがある。そして、RubyIZUMIではH.264+ AACに対応しているのが特徴だ。 MP4ファイルが入っているフォルダを指定してサーバを立ち上げ、後は付属しているASファイルをコンパイ

    MOONGIFT: � Rubyで作られたRTMPサーバ「RubyIZUMI」:オープンソースを毎日紹介
  • MOONGIFT: » オープンソースのFLVプレーヤ「NonverBlaster」:オープンソースを毎日紹介

    Webブラウザ上で何でも行うようになっている。ビューワーについてはFlashが秀逸で、音楽を聴いたり、動画を見たり、ドキュメントを閲覧するようなことがブラウザ上だけで完結するようになっている。 動画はどのサービスでも有効に使われているが、自サイト内でプレーヤを提供したければこちらをどうぞ。 今回紹介するオープンソース・ソフトウェアはNonverBlaster、オープンソースのFLVプレーヤだ。 NonverBlasterはシンプルなインタフェースのFLVプレーヤで、再生と音量調整、そしてフルスクリーンモードがサポートされている。URLでFLVファイルを指定するだけで使える手軽さが良い。 自動再生、フルスクリーンモードの許可、各種色の設定などをJavaScriptから行えるのも特徴だ。再生するだけであれば、プレーヤは殆ど変更する必要はなく、HTML側だけで終われるのが嬉しい点だ。 自分の撮っ

    MOONGIFT: » オープンソースのFLVプレーヤ「NonverBlaster」:オープンソースを毎日紹介
  • プログラマのためのFlash遊び方

    今回からは、実践的なFlash作りを始めていきます。ActionScriptで簡単な図形描画をしながらActionScript 3.0の感覚をつかんでいきましょう。 最初は地味なサンプルと退屈な文法の解説が続きますが、後編では次のようなWeb 2.0 風バッジをActionScriptだけで描画します。がんばってついてきてください。 サンプルコードをコンパイルしよう 円や四角を描画するだけの簡単なサンプルを用意しました。味気ないサンプルですが、ActionScript 3.0の基がたっぷり詰まっています。 package{ ------(1) import flash.display.Sprite; ------(2) public class DrawTest1 extends Sprite { ------(3) public function DrawTest1() { -----

    プログラマのためのFlash遊び方
  • http://blog.itoyanagi.name/entries/d20080318

  • 第1回 無料でFlash作りに挑戦!Flex 3 SDKを導入してみよう | gihyo.jp

    Flashを作るには何万円もする専用ソフトが必要…、デザイナーが使うものだから敷居が高い…。そう考えてる方も多いのではないでしょうか。実はそんなことはありません。 Adobe社が無料で提供している開発環境「Flex 3 SDK」を利用すれば、ActionScript 3.0というプログラミング言語でFlashを作成できます。ActionScript 3.0はECMAScriptに準拠しているため、プログラマの方にとってもなじみやすい言語といえます。 この連載ではプログラマの方に向けて、サンプルを交えながら、ActionScriptでFlashを作る手法を解説していきます。 ActionScript 3.0でHello World! いきなりですが、ActionScript 3.0のサンプルコードを見てみましょう。定番のHello World!です。 package{ import flas

    第1回 無料でFlash作りに挑戦!Flex 3 SDKを導入してみよう | gihyo.jp
  • 各種ドキュメントをFlash化·Print2Flash Free Edition MOONGIFT

    ちょっと前までは文書をPDF化するのが便利だった。プリンタドライバとして動作するPDF作成ツールも数多く登場している。PDFを作成するのは決して難しいものではなくなっている。 次の段階はドキュメントのFlash化だ。この利点は何だろう、閲覧は当然としてブラウザ内で見られるのが便利な点だ。 今回紹介するフリーウェアはPrint2Flash Free Edition、プリンタドライバとして動作するFlash生成ソフトウェアだ。 実はPrint2Flash自体はフリー版ではないものを持っている。Memotuneの中で一時的に利用していた。FlashPaper同様にFlashであればOSの垣根を越えて、さらにブラウザ内でインライン表示できるのが便利だ。 Print2Flash Free Editionはそのフリー版であり、個人の非商用に限って無料で利用できる。利用方法は簡単で、プリンタのように印刷

    各種ドキュメントをFlash化·Print2Flash Free Edition MOONGIFT
  • MOONGIFT: » ついにFlex3がオープンソース化「Flex3SDK」:オープンソースを毎日紹介

    今年こそFlashをはじめよう、と思いつつも二ヶ月も過ぎてしまった。皆さんの中にもFlashに興味は持ちつつも、なかなか手出しできない方がいらっしゃるのではないだろうか。原因としては二つある。Flashと聞くとデザイン的なものを思い浮かべてしまうこと、そしてもう一つは有料という思い込みだ。 二つとも一気に解消してくれるのがこのソフトウェアだ。 今回紹介するオープンソース・ソフトウェアはFlex3SDK、オープンソース版のFlex開発ツールだ。 FlexはFlashとは異なり、プログラマブルな手法でアプリケーションを構築する。Flex Builder3というデザインツールもあるがこちらは有料だ。しかしFlex3SDKだけでも十分に開発ができる。むしろエンジニアにはこちらの方が良いかも知れない。 そして何よりもオープンソースであることが大きい。これを使えばFlex3を使ったソフトウェアの構築が

    MOONGIFT: » ついにFlex3がオープンソース化「Flex3SDK」:オープンソースを毎日紹介
  • 窓の杜 - 【NEWS】FLV動画を無劣化で編集できる“Adobe AIR”製ソフト「RichFLV」

    FLV動画を無劣化で編集できるソフト「RichFLV」v4.0 Betaが、26日に公開された。Windowsに対応するフリーソフトで、編集部にてWindows XP/Vistaで動作確認した。現在作者のホームページからダウンロードできる。なお、動作には「Adobe AIR」v1.0が必要。 「RichFLV」は、動画をプレビューしながら無劣化で切り出し・結合できるFLV専用動画編集ソフト。動画編集のほか、FLV動画から音声をMP3形式で抽出したり、FLV動画にMP3音声を付加することもできる。さらに、FLV動画をSWF形式に変換することも可能。 画面は3ペイン型で、左上にはプレビューが、右上には動画のメタデータやキーフレーム一覧などの情報が、画面下部には操作ボタンとシークバーなどが表示される。また、画面をプレビューのみの表示に切り替えることも可能。 動画の切り出しを行うには、画面下部にあ

  • MyTubeの作り方 - 書評 - FFmpegで作る動画共有サイト : 404 Blog Not Found

    2008年02月13日09:00 カテゴリ書評/画評/品評Lightweight Languages MyTubeの作り方 - 書評 - FFmpegで作る動画共有サイト 毎日コミュニケーションズ出版事業部編集第3部書籍編集1課の田島様より献御礼。 FFmpegで作る動画共有サイト 月村潤 + 間雅洋 + 堀田直孝 + 原一浩 + 足立健誌 + 尾花衣美 + 堀内康弘 + 寺田学 こちらがもたもたしている間に、すでに F's Garage:「FFmpegで作る動画共有サイト」を読んだ という具合に書評が先を越されてしまったが、ネットで動画を扱うための参考としては出色の出来である。 書「FFmpegで作る動画共有サイト」は、動画処理ライブラリーとしてもっともポピュラーなFFmpegを軸に、YouTubeやニコニコ動画のようなサイトを自作するために必要な知識を過不足なく一冊のにまと

    MyTubeの作り方 - 書評 - FFmpegで作る動画共有サイト : 404 Blog Not Found
  • Flashプログラミングメモ

    フィジカルコンピューティング Gainerメモ フィジカルコンピューティングに利用できるI/Oモジュールのメモ。 Arduinoメモ フィジカルコンピューティングに利用できるI/Oモジュールのメモ。 PC AIRメモ Flash技術を利用したデスクトップアプリケーション実行環境のメモ。 ActionScript 3.0メモ Flash Player 9以降で実行できるオブジェクト指向プログラミング言語のメモ。 Flex 2で開発。 ActionScript 2.0メモ Flash Player 7以降で実行できるオブジェクト指向プログラミング言語のメモ。 mtascで開発。Flash Lite 2.0情報も含む。 AIF Toolkitメモ Flash Player 10用のフィルター作成ソフトのメモ。 Flash Media Server 2メモ flvの配信や複数クラ

  • Sprout で遊んでみました。

    ということで、リリースされたばかりの新しいサービス"Sprout"(スプラウト、芽や芽生えるという意味)で遊んでみました。昨日のエントリでも引用しましたが、TechCrunch に詳しい解説が出ています: ■ Sprout:Flash用オンラインWYSIWYGエディタ (TechCrunch Japanese) Flash を作成するオンラインツールなのですが、ブログパーツ(失礼、「スプラウト」と呼ばなければいけないんでしたね)を作るのに特化していると考えれば分かりやすいです。サイズを指定して、あとは用意されているいくつかのコンポーネントを組み合わせるだけで、簡単に以下のような Flash を作成できます: 当にてきとーなサンプルで申し訳ありません……「簡単に作れる」というのと、「センスがある作品が作れる」というのは別の話ということで。見ていただければ分かると思いますが、文字や画像は当然

    Sprout で遊んでみました。
  • 続・Flexでターミナルエミュレータ - Blog by Sadayuki Furuhashi

    予想外に反響をいただいた前回ですが、なんと空前のTTYブームが来ていたとは! そんなこんなでソースコードも公開しました。CodeReposのlang/actoinscript/FxTermにあります。 二日目の成果はこんな感じです↓ 背景色が出るようになりました!カーソルが見えるようになりました! 前回は色付きのテキストを表示するためにTextクラスのhtmlTextを利用していたのですが、これだとやたら泥臭い(色が変わるたびに<font color="#FF0000">... & いちいちタグをエスケープしないといけない)し、その上背景色を設定できなかったので、SpriteクラスにTextFieldクラスで文字列を描画していくようにしてみました。ちょっとだけスマートになっています。 今のところの問題点は… 日語は出るけどちょっと化ける 日語を入力できない 画面の左側に変な色が出ている

    続・Flexでターミナルエミュレータ - Blog by Sadayuki Furuhashi
  • グニャラは大変なFlashを描いていきました - グニャラくんのグニャグニャ備忘録@はてな

    今週末は2つの勉強会に参加・発表させていただきました! ステキな発表の場を設けていただいてありがとうございます!! 両方ともActionScript/Flashについて(?)の発表です。 それぞれ発表資料を公開させていただきます。 Flash + JavaScriptでmemcachedと直接通信 @ さかとくカンファレンス ActionScript3上で、Socketを用いてmemcachedとの通信を行うモジュールを書きました。 さらに、そのモジュールをJavaScriptから呼べるようにしました。 get/setしかサポートしてないですし、 全体的に設計とコーディングが小汚いです。 ちょっと恥ずかしいけど、 CodeReposにアップしているので適当に直してもらえると嬉しいです… プログラム体・発表資料は以下に置いております。 CodeReposのレポジトリパス 発表資料(PDF

    グニャラは大変なFlashを描いていきました - グニャラくんのグニャグニャ備忘録@はてな
    t_43z
    t_43z 2008/01/28
    内容と全然関係ないけど、グニャラさんが大学の同期生だと今気がついた。
  • オープンソースFlex開発フレームワークが示すプラットフォームの大きな動き

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

    オープンソースFlex開発フレームワークが示すプラットフォームの大きな動き
  • ディレクターのための「Flash Lite」入門 - livedoor ディレクター Blog

    こんにちは。ライブドアでモバイルサイトを担当している伊藤です。モバイルの世界では、モバイル特有のサイト構築に関する技術や、PC のものをモバイルコンテンツ向けに作り直した技術が使われていて、ほとんどの仕様がPCと異なります。今回はその中のひとつである「Flash Lite」について書きます。 モバイル向けの「Flash」である「Flash Lite」は、ところどころで使われはじめているものの、格的に使われるのはまだまだこれからというのが現状です。ただ、活気を帯びてきている技術の一つで、昨年末、新しいバージョンの「Flash Lite 3.0」が発表されたことは、今後モバイルサイトにおいて大きな意味を持ってくるでしょう。そこで、モバイルディレクターとして最低限、知っておきたいと思うことをまとめてみました。 【01】「Flash Lite」とは 「Flash Lite」はバージョン1.0から

    ディレクターのための「Flash Lite」入門 - livedoor ディレクター Blog
  • Flashの要となるスクリプト言語「ActionScript」とは?

    Flashの要となるスクリプト言語「ActionScript」とは?:Flashの基礎を無料で習得! ActionScript入門(1)(1/3 ページ) ActionScriptって何だろう? 難しい? そんな方のために今回から始まりました「ActionScript入門」シリーズです。この記事が皆さんのActionScriptを学ぶきっかけになれば幸いです。途中、聞き慣れない言葉が出てくることもあるかもしれませんが、気軽にお付き合いください。 そもそもActionScriptって何? JavaScriptとは違うの? 「ActionScript」とは、アドビ システムズ製のFlashで用いられている、SWFファイル開発用のスクリプト言語です。SWFファイルはFlashの実行環境Flash Player上で動作するアプリケーションです。スクリプト言語といえば、JavaScriptが有名です

    Flashの要となるスクリプト言語「ActionScript」とは?
  • 天井からぶらさげる 百匹目の猿

    天井からぶらさげる 天井からひもがぶら下がってる風にボールを配置します。 ボールはつかめます。 各ボールは間隔が固定されて数珠つなぎになってます。先頭のボールは天井に固定、それ以外のボールは重力で下に落ちようとします。 つかんだボールはマウスカーソルの位置に固定されます。 このサンプルのActionScriptは以下です。第一フレームのアクションとして記述しています。 // 節の数 var pointCnt:int = 10; // 節の間隔 var dist:Number = 20; // x座標 var initX:Number = stage.stageWidth / 2; // 重力加速度 var gravity:Number = .5; // つかんでいる節 var target:Object = null; // 節の配列 var pointArray:Array = [];

    t_43z
    t_43z 2008/01/06
    ActionScript勉強中のブログ
  • JavaとFlex/AIRをつなぐ「炎」のオープンソース(1/3) ─ @IT

    JavaとFlex/AIRをつなぐ「炎」のオープンソース Tomcatを使ったサーバPushもできるBlazeDSとは? クラスメソッド株式会社 友田 翼 2007/12/27 2007年12月13日に米国アドビシステムズ社(以下、アドビ社)から「BlazeDS」というオープンソースプロジェクトが公開され、現在Adobe LabsからBlazeDSのパブリックベータ版がダウンロード可能になっています(参照「アドビ、「BlazeDS」はAjax+JSONの4倍速い~リモーティング、メッセージングのOSS~」)。ちなみに、Blazeは英語で「炎」の意味ですね。 稿では、オープンソースになったBlazeDSについて、付属されているサンプルアプリケーションを見ながら、いったいどんなものであるのかを紹介していきたいと思います。 「炎のデータ・サービス」? BlazeDSとは何なのか? BlazeD

  • 使えるFlashツール集『Flash Tools』 – creamu

    Flashのエフェクトなどを簡単に作りたい。 そんなあなたにおすすめなのが、『Flash Tools』。使えるFlashツール集だ。 以下にいくつかご紹介。 » IncrediFlash Intro and Banner Studio Flashの知識がなくてもバナーやイントロのエフェクトを作成できる。100以上のテキストエフェクトなど。↑のキャプチャはこのサイト » Micro Menu サイトに使えるFlashナビゲーション » Flash Effect Maker Pro Flashエフェクトメーカー 使えるFlashツール集、チェックして使っていきたいですね。 やっと週末、連休ですね。結構まったりしています。 昨日急に実装したくなったRSSのTickerをトップページに置きました。 Flashのことで頭がいっぱいなのでをたくさん購入。 左から2冊目のEssential Bookは

  • 機能変更、お知らせなど - はてな技術発表会日記 - 3月22日の技術勉強会 - ActionScript3 / Flex / Apollo 勉強会

    8月17日の技術勉強会 - Flexレイアウト手書き勉強会 8月17日に行われました技術発表会の内容を撮影した動画ファイル/資料を公開いたしました。内容は以下のとおりです。 テーマ Flexレイアウト手書き勉強会 発表者 d:id:secondlife 勉強会動画 ダウンロード…

    機能変更、お知らせなど - はてな技術発表会日記 - 3月22日の技術勉強会 - ActionScript3 / Flex / Apollo 勉強会